AY238 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: AY - Deprec. simulation - maint. module (AIPS) /gen. master data

  • Message number: 238

  • Message text: Choose a task

    The SAP error message AY238, which states "Choose a task," typically occurs in the context of SAP Business Workflow or when working with tasks in the SAP system. This error indicates that the user is required to select a specific task or action to proceed, but none has been selected or available.
    
    Cause: No Task Selected: The user has not selected any task from the available options. Workflow Configuration: There may be an issue with the workflow configuration, where tasks are not properly defined or assigned.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or select tasks. System Errors: There could be a temporary system error or glitch that is preventing tasks from being displayed.
